Re: cell phone question
« Reply #3 on: February 23, 2009, 01:54:25 PM »
If I am not mistaken, sprint uses the same network that verizon does.  Verizon uses cdma signals.  ATT uses gsm signals.  CDMA is not compatible with GSM and visa versa.  Therefore verizon/sprint phones will not work with att/tmobile.
